Meaning and Origin
Niecy is a diminutive form of the name Denise, which itself has roots in ancient Greece. Its origin lies in the name Diónūsos, a combination of "Zeús" (Zeus, representing heavenliness and divinity) and "Nûsa" (mountainous land). Nysa, in Greek mythology, is linked to the nymphs who nurtured the infant god Dionysus, bestowing upon it a connection to the god of wine, celebrations, and festivities, as well as madness, chaos, and eternal youth.
Pronunciation and Spelling
Niecy is a straightforward name to pronounce, with the emphasis falling on the first syllable. Its phonetic spelling ensures that most individuals can easily grasp its pronunciation, eliminating potential for mispronunciation. While the name is typically spelled "Niecy," it's important to be aware of alternative spellings, like "Nici" or "Nissey."
